The Impact of Cranial Massage
The head area is often ignored in daily wellness practices, yet it's home to thousands of nerve endings. When engaged softly, these areas can relieve pressure, calm the mind, and even encourage growth by stimulating the follicles. Whether you're decompressing after a long workday or simply making a moment for yourself, a quality massage device can transform downtime into a soothing experience.
What makes these tools uniquely beneficial is their versatility. They're portable, user-friendly, and great for anyone seeking a gentle way to take a break. Enhanced by essential oils or as part of your bath routine, the sensation becomes even more soothing.
